What is Potassium Methyl Siliconate?

Potassium methyl siliconate is a water repellent agent. It's used in various construction materials, especially masonry. This compound forms a protective layer that prevents water from penetrating. It is essential for maintaining the integrity of your building.

Application Process

Applying potassium methyl siliconate is simple. Here’s what you need to do:

  1. Clean the Surface: Ensure the masonry surface is clean and dry.
  2. Prepare the Solution: Dilute the chemical as per the manufacturer’s instructions.
  3. Apply Evenly: Use a sprayer or brush to apply the solution uniformly.
  4. Let it Dry: Allow adequate time for drying before any further work.

Why is Water Repellent Important?

Moisture can cause significant damage to masonry. Over time, water can lead to cracks, mold, and structural issues. Protecting masonry is crucial.
